Transaction c6ecc408978759597598ef13093ccf81dd150f3216cb919b38ac0c4cb76b0ec5
1 Input
1 Output
-
c6ecc408978759597598ef13093ccf81dd150f3216cb919b38ac0c4cb76b0ec5:0
- value
- 5962656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cfc6e2d30bd0ab2df6867c300d9acf10d5a2f8c OP_EQUAL
- address
- 3EYUva23WjtDqokqdPhAMU8RwJDCX3NxZz